Judgement Of Torque Converter Stall Test Results

  1. Stall speed is high when selector lever is in both "D" and "R" ranges.
    • Malfunction of the torque converter (Torque converter and input shaft spline are slipping)
    • Malfunction of the valve body
    • Damaged wiring harness and connectors
    • Malfunction of TCM
  2. Stall speed is high only when selector lever is in the "D" range.
    • Forward clutch is slipping
  3. Stall speed is high only when the selector lever is in the "R" range.
    • Reverse brake is slipping
  4. Stall speed is low when selector lever is in both "D" and "R" ranges.
    • Malfunction of the torque converter
    • Line pressure is low
    • Low engine power
